Making the UK a Science and Innovation Leader in Metamaterials

The UK Metamaterials Network (UKMMN) is the home of the UK metamaterials community, providing leadership to drive the national metamaterials agenda. A thriving and active community, the UKMMN consists of over 1000 members from institutions across the UK and abroad, bringing metamaterials stakeholders together from all domains and sectors. It connects academia, industry, and Government benefiting UK security and prosperity.

The UKMMN was awarded NetworkPlus status in 2024 with a £2.5 million investment (c.£3,5 million over the lifetime of the Network and NetworkPlus) until September 2028. This significant investment supports the metamaterials community’s activities, bringing together experts from multiple domains and perspectives to collaborate and build a self-sustaining community.
